#4a0663 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#4a0663 is composed of 29% red, 2.4% green and 38.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 25.3% cyan, 93.9% magenta, 0% yellow and 61.2% black. It has a hue angle of 283.9 degrees, a saturation of 88.6% and a lightness of 20.6%. #4a0663 color hex could be obtained by blending #940cc6 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#330066.

Shades and Tints of #4a0663
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#050007 is the darkest color, while #fbf3fe is the lightest one.
